掌握CSS网格:UltrasDzCoder课程深度解析

需积分: 5 0 下载量 154 浏览量 更新于2025-01-02 收藏 2KB ZIP 举报
资源摘要信息:"UltrasDzCoder在CSS网格中学习课程" CSS网格布局是一种强大的二维布局系统,它允许网页设计师以网格的形式来布局网页中的元素。在本课程中,将详细介绍CSS网格布局的相关知识点,并通过具体的实例演示如何使用CSS网格进行网页设计。 首先,课程将介绍CSS网格布局的基本概念,包括网格容器、网格项、网格线以及网格轨道等术语。这些是理解和使用CSS网格布局的基础,对于初学者来说,掌握这些概念是学习后续内容的前提。 接着,课程内容会深入到CSS网格布局的各项属性,例如`display: grid;`属性用于定义一个网格容器,`grid-template-columns`和`grid-template-rows`用于定义网格轨道的大小和数量,`grid-gap`用于定义网格项之间的间隙,以及`justify-content`和`align-content`等属性用于控制网格内容的对齐方式。 此外,课程还将讲解CSS网格布局中的高级功能,如使用命名网格线、创建多列布局以及运用网格区域来管理复杂布局。这些功能能够帮助设计师更精细地控制网格布局的方方面面,实现更加丰富的视觉效果和更灵活的布局调整。 在实践环节中,通过UltrasDzCoder的案例分析,学习者可以将理论知识应用到实际项目中,巩固所学内容。课程鼓励学员对每个示例进行模仿和实验,通过这种方式加深对网格布局的理解。 整个课程是面向HTML和CSS初学者以及有一定基础希望进一步提升的前端开发者的。课程强调实战演练,鼓励学习者在练习中发现问题、解决问题,并在实际项目中运用所学的网格布局技术。通过本课程的学习,学员将能够熟练掌握CSS网格布局技术,并在自己的网页设计工作中灵活运用,提升布局的专业性和美观度。 最后,课程会提供一些额外的资源和工具推荐,比如网格布局设计的灵感来源、在线编辑器以及调试工具等,帮助学员在学习过程中更高效地学习和实践CSS网格布局。 需要注意的是,尽管课程的主要内容围绕CSS网格布局展开,但为了实现更完整的网页布局,学习者需要对HTML的基础知识有一定了解。在课程中,会适时回顾和应用HTML的基础知识,确保学习者能够更好地理解和掌握CSS网格布局在实际网页设计中的应用。 综上所述,本课程不仅为初学者提供了入门CSS网格布局的全面指导,也为有经验的开发者提供了深入学习的机会,是提升网页布局设计技能的宝贵资源。